Use and selection of roost sites by Eurasian Griffon Vultures Gyps fulvus in Bulgaria

摘要

Capsule Roosting behaviour during the pre-breeding season is an important part of the Eurasian Griffon Vulture Gyps fulvus life cycle. We demonstrate the importance of roost site selection and its relation to the breeding distribution of the Griffon Vulture. Aims To quantify the distribution, population size, age structure and roosting site selection of the Eurasian Griffon Vulture in the Eastern Rhodopes, Bulgaria during the pre-breeding season. Methods We used correlation analysis and generalized linear mixed models to examine the relationship between the vultures use of roost sites and their distribution in relation to topographic variables. We additionally used GPS telemetry data from 25 birds to study and compare the use of roosting cliffs. Results During the 14-year survey period the number of roosting Eurasian Griffon Vultures gradually increased from 25 birds in 2005 to 201 in 2018. We recorded 16 cliffs used by 124 +/- 51 (sd) vultures for roosting. The number of non-adult vultures increased by 25 and reached 41 of all the recorded birds in the last year of the survey. We found that the number of breeding pairs correlated positively with the number of roosting vultures (r( )= 0.85) and that roosting cliff selection was determined by cliff length and height, distance to the nearest feeding site, and whether the cliff was used for breeding. Conclusions Cliffs regularly used by vultures in the pre-breeding season, were afterwards used for breeding. Thus, cliffs used in the pre-breeding season for roosting could be used as an index for the breeding distribution of the species, and should be protected to sustain the species in and out of the breeding season.
